Heads up: the Cartflow checkout load test keeps tripping at the payment stub, not the app itself. The stub pool maxes out around 400 virtual users, so anything above that reads as false 502s. Bump the stub replicas before rerunning, and ignore latency spikes in the first two minutes. The failing run's token is below.

trace token, fafof-tajef: htk9_849b0fd88

# Break-Glass: Catalog Cache Invalidation

Scope: the Pinrow product catalog at Veldstone Retail. If stale prices persist after a purge and the Hollowmere invalidation queue is wedged, use break-glass to flush the edge tier directly. Contractors: get verbal sign-off from the catalog lead first. Steps: open the Hollowmere admin shell, select emergency-flush, confirm the tenant, and run it once — repeated flushes thrash the origin. Access is logged and expires after 20 minutes. Unseal the admin shell with the passphrase below.

recovery phrase for kahop-tajog: istix-casvan

- [ ] Step 7: Archive cold storage buckets (Glacierline tier). Confirm both ceremony witnesses are present, verify bucket manifests match the Oxbow ledger, then seal the archive key shares. Plugin authors may observe but not handle shares. Once sealed, the archive index itself is encrypted and can only be reopened with the passphrase below.

vault phrase of badup-hahig = tamael-aldael-kelmir-istael-fenok-istwyn-tamius-jorath-oliion

Subject: Transition to Annual Billing

Branch Managers,

Effective next fiscal year, Harrowfield Analytics will move all standard subscriptions from monthly to annual billing. Customers on the Cindra platform will be notified in phases, starting with accounts renewing after April. Expect a short-term dip in new signups and an uptick in support queries; staffing guidance follows next week.

Please brief your teams on the mechanics only — pricing rationale stays at this level for now. The confidential business context appears directly below.

internal memo for yahag-hahig: Belwynix Group plans to lower the Silir list price by 62 percent in May.